CSCI120 HM - Human-Centered Computing Methods Credit(s): 3
Description: This course provides an overview and introduction to human-centered computing methods. It introduces students to tools, techniques, and practices to inform a systematic approach to design research. Students will gain experience using some of the following methods: think alouds, surveys, interviews, storyboarding, and prototyping. By the end of the course, students will have a portfolio to showcase the skills picked up in the class.
Prerequisite(s): Junior or senior standing and CSCI070 HM
